文化的背景
Dutch people value their sleep and routine. It is common to announce when you are going to bed. Similar to the Netherlands, but sometimes even more indirect in social settings. In many cultures, announcing you are going to sleep is seen as a sign of respect to the host.
The 'Graag' Rule
Always use 'graag' when you want something. It is the magic word for politeness in Dutch.
Social Exit
Using this phrase is a socially acceptable way to leave a conversation without offending anyone.
